Stewed Cabbage with Ribs

A wonderful dish for everyday menu - cabbage stew with ribs. And in the preparation of this completely ordinary food, you can easily excel, using as different types of cabbage in different states (fresh, pickled, sour), and meat of different animals.

The traditional option - smoked pork ribs, stewed with fresh, well, or sauerkraut (pickled, salted or pickled cabbage, of course, you must first rinse).

Stewed cabbage with smoked ribs

Ingredients:

Preparation

We cut and cut the pork ribs. Cut the pieces of fat and cut them into cracklings, from which we heat the fat in the cauldron, and fry onions, sliced ​​in quarter rings. Add the ribs and fry until light brown-golden shade. Add the chopped cabbage and spices. Stir and stew until ready cabbage (ribs are ready) on low heat, covering the lid, stirring occasionally. During the process, we add wine and, if necessary, water, and near the end - add tomato paste. You do not need to salt - in smoked salt is enough.

Ready stewed cabbage with ribs is laid out on plates and abundantly seasoned with chopped herbs and garlic.

It will be much more useful in the preparation of this dish to use not smoked meat, but fresh raw meat products. In this case, the technology will look slightly different.

Recipe for stewed cabbage with pork ribs

Preparation

Carrots cut into short thin straws, and onions - quarter rings. A piece of lard is crushed into cracklings and we heat from them fat in the cauldron. Let's cut the chopped onion with carrots. Add the chopped ribs and spices. Lightly fry all together, stirring with a spatula (for about 5-8 minutes). Reduce fire and stew for about 30-40 minutes, closing the lid, if necessary, stirring with a spatula and pouring water. Closer to the very end of the process, add tomato paste, chopped greens and garlic.

Ribs with cabbage can be served light table wine, kymmel and / or light beer.
